1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Newton's Third Law of Motion?
Back
For every action, there is an equal and opposite reaction.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What do we mean by 'force pairs'?
Back
Forces that two objects exert on each other, which are equal in magnitude and opposite in direction.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What unit is used to measure force?
Back
Newton (N) is the unit used to measure force.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If two objects collide, what can we say about the forces they exert on each other?
Back
They exert equal and opposite forces on each other.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
True or False: All forces occur in pairs.
Back
True.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ens when a person jumps off a diving board?
Back
The person exerts a downward force on the board, and the board exerts an equal upward force on the person.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an example of Newton's Third Law in sports?
Back
When a player kicks a ball, the ball exerts an equal and opposite force back on the player's foot.
